For those of you with kitties...Here is my advice. Fill the underneath with presents so that there isn't any place for them to climb from. Also, I went and bought bell ornaments. I call them tattelers. This way if someone is messing with the tree the little bells will ring and tattle on the kitties. Another thing that seems to be working so far is to keep the vacuum out and when they start to mess with it turn the vac on and they run far away as quick as they can.

I'm so glad you liked the tree! Here's a photo of the tree a few years ago. I'll also try to do another close-up for some of the details.

The ribbon is just inexpensive red plaid ribbon and I save it and iron it every year then tie bows on the ends of the boughs, plus a larger bow on top. I first got the idea for the cloth ornaments from my childhood where we grew up with cats and the tree went over several years in a row with a cat riding it all the way down. We don't have cats now but we have had a dog tail or two wag some of the ornaments off so it's good they're unbreakable. These kind of ornaments are harder to find now, but I usually find something every year or two, often at craft fairs.

The brass bead garlands were just some drugstore cheapies from a few years ago. I don't remember when or where I got the straw garlands.
